In early July, the Ministry of Education of China announced the closure of 229 internationally collaborative academic programmes and five internationally collaborative institutions. Normally these institutions and programmes are used as Zhongwai Hezuo Banxue in Chinese, meaning they represent co-operation between Chinese universities and foreign partners.

The government has attempted to reduce and terminate non-degree programmes carried out by Zhongwai Hezuo Banxue institutions since the early 2000s. Recently some undergraduate programmes, especially in business and management, have also been abolished. The numbers were quite limited, however. This time the situation appears to be more complicated and offers more profound implications for the future development of such institutions and programmes.
